博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
上传文件,比较完善
阅读量:6231 次
发布时间:2019-06-21

本文共 822 字,大约阅读时间需要 2 分钟。

protected void btnfileup_Click(object sender, EventArgs e)

   {
       try
       {
           if (FileUpload1.PostedFile.FileName == "")
           {
               Page.ClientScript.RegisterStartupScript(Page.GetType(), "message", "<script language='javascript' defer>alert('文件名称不能为空!');</script>");
               return;
           }
           else
           {
               FileUpload1.PostedFile.SaveAs(Server.MapPath("file/" + FileUpload1.PostedFile.FileName.Substring(FileUpload1.PostedFile.FileName.LastIndexOf("\\")+1)));
               Page.ClientScript.RegisterStartupScript(Page.GetType(), "message", "<script language='javascript' defer>alert('上传成功!');</script>");
           }
       }
       catch (Exception ex)
       {

           Response.Write(ex.Message.ToString());

           Page.ClientScript.RegisterStartupScript(Page.GetType(), "message", "<script language='javascript' defer>alert('上传失败!');</script>");

       }
   }

转载于:https://www.cnblogs.com/houweidong/archive/2013/02/14/2911189.html

你可能感兴趣的文章
我的友情链接
查看>>
Ez×××客户端在服务器侧没有配置隧道分离的情况下如何直接上公网
查看>>
如何备份cisco路由器配置文件
查看>>
部署Symantec Antivirus 10.0网络防毒服务器之六
查看>>
《paste命令》-linux命令五分钟系列之二十
查看>>
CTO职场解惑指南系列(一)
查看>>
安排!活动素材的亿级用户精准投放
查看>>
debian8.4下配置pgpool+pg9.5双主备
查看>>
用scrapy爬取ttlsa博文相关数据存储至mysql
查看>>
我的友情链接
查看>>
我的友情链接
查看>>
AOP 的利器:ASM 3.0 介绍
查看>>
Redis数据结构详解,五种数据结构分分钟掌握
查看>>
解决Linux下编译.sh文件报错 “[: XXXX: unexpected operator”
查看>>
使用JConsole监控
查看>>
开发规范
查看>>
RAID技术
查看>>
excel 使用 navicat 导入数据库
查看>>
我的友情链接
查看>>
我的大学——我在科创协会的部长感悟
查看>>